Feature intéressa intéressera
Definition Troisième personne du singulier du passé simple de intéresser. Troisième personne du singulier du futur de intéresser.

Spelling & Dictionary Insight

A purely visual mix-up. intéressa (\ɛ̃.te.ʁɛ.sa\) and intéressera (\ɛ̃.te.ʁɛ.sə.ʁa\) are said differently, so reading them aloud is the quickest way to catch the wrong one.
